This PDF document exploits multiple known vulnerabilities in Adobe Reader, including CVE-2009-4324, CVE-2009-0927, CVE-2007-5659, and CVE-2008-2992. The exploit is delivered via JavaScript embedded within the PDF's metadata, specifically using a technique that reconstructs the JavaScript payload from character ranges within the /Producer field. This JavaScript is designed to download and execute a second-stage payload, although the specific payload could not be recovered. The ML classifier strongly indicates malicious intent.

Heuristics 8

  • media.newPlayer — CVE-2009-4324 critical CVE exact CVE_2009_4324
    PDF JavaScript calls media.newPlayer — CVE-2009-4324 is a use-after-free in Adobe Reader's multimedia plugin triggered by media.newPlayer(). Actively exploited as a zero-day in December 2009. (identified after JavaScript deobfuscation)
  • Collab.getIcon — CVE-2009-0927 critical CVE exact CVE_2009_0927
    PDF JavaScript calls Collab.getIcon — CVE-2009-0927 is a stack buffer overflow in Adobe Reader triggered by Collab.getIcon() with a crafted argument. Allows arbitrary code execution. (identified after JavaScript deobfuscation)
  • Collab.collectEmailInfo — CVE-2007-5659 critical CVE exact CVE_2007_5659
    PDF JavaScript calls Collab.collectEmailInfo — CVE-2007-5659 is a buffer overflow in Adobe Reader triggered by a long argument or heap-sprayed message field passed to Collab.collectEmailInfo(). Part of a series of Acrobat JS API exploits. (identified after JavaScript deobfuscation)
  • util.printf — CVE-2008-2992 critical CVE exact CVE_2008_2992
    PDF JavaScript calls util.printf() — CVE-2008-2992 is a stack buffer overflow in Adobe Reader triggered by a long format-specifier argument. Widely exploited in the wild after disclosure. (identified after JavaScript deobfuscation)
  • PDF /Producer character-range JavaScript stager high PDF_INFO_PRODUCER_CHAR_RANGE_JS_STAGER
    PDF metadata hides JavaScript in /Producer as character ranges plus a long numeric index table. The document JavaScript rebuilds an alphabet from those ranges, maps the indexes into characters, and evals the recovered exploit stage. The decoder is bounded and only fires when the recovered stage contains exploit-like Acrobat JavaScript.
